# Chilean opposition criticizes President Kast's Madrid Forum role, plans 'Democracy Always' counter-event

Chilean opposition parties are denouncing the conservative Madrid Forum, where President José Antonio Kast will speak, and will hold a counter-event on Thursday.

Argentina's Casa Rosada confirmed that Argentine President Javier Milei will attend the Madrid Forum and will hold a bilateral meeting with Chilean President José Antonio Kast at La Moneda on Thursday. [^1]

Chilean President José Antonio Kast will deliver one of the main speeches at the Madrid Forum. [^2]

Paulina Vodanovic, senator and president of the Socialist Party (PS), said on Monday that the government represents a 'threat to democracy' and expressed concern about Kast's adherence to an ideology contrary to democracy. [^3]

The Madrid Forum, organized by the Disenso Foundation (linked to Spain's Vox party), will take place on September 3 and 4, 2026, at the San Carlos de Apoquindo Events Center in Santiago, Chile. [^4]

Chilean opposition leader Eduardo Cretton stated that President Javier Milei must ratify Chilean sovereignty over the Magallanes Strait without ambiguity during his visit. [^5]

Paulina Vodanovic, President of the Socialist Party, argued that the Chilean government's reaction was too late and that the sovereignty issue requires a formal state-level confrontation rather than an informal coffee meeting. [^6]

Tensions between Chile and Argentina have increased after Gustavo Valverde, head of the Argentine Air Force, questioned Chilean sovereignty over the Magallanes Strait. [^7]
